Job Description:
An exciting opportunity for an HR Advisor has arisen to join our client based in Pangbourne. You will be supporting the HR Manager in ensuring that the HR Function provides a professional service. This is a temporary to permanent opportunity and we are looking for someone that is available to start immediately.
*Location: Pangbourne - fully office based
*Salary: £14.50 - £17.00 per hour - depending on experience
*Working Hours: 8.30am - 5pm or 9am - 5.30pm
As the HR Advisor, you will be responsible for:
*Managing end to end recruitment process
*Create & update job descriptions / person specifications
*Write and post job adverts.
*Source candidates & liaise with recruitment agencies
*Arrange interviews both face to face & online
*Arrange temporary supply cover as required.
*Produce offer letters and contracts
*Send out new starter documents
*Managing onboarding including completing new starter checklist, right to work checks and references
*Arrange Inductions for staff
*Assist with payroll
*Absence management
*Arrange training as and when required
*Update register/spreadsheet of attendees
*Any other ad hoc duties as and when required
The successful HR Advisor will have the following related skills & experience:
*Previous experience of working in a busy HR position is essential for this role
*Studying towards your CIPD qualification would be advantageous but not essential
*A positive and outgoing attitude is required as well as the ability to communicate with a wide range of people.
*Excellent attention to detail and organisation skills are required
*Proficient user of MS Office
*Experience of Moorepay would be advantageous but not essential.
*Due to the location, you will need to be a driver with your own transport
